Water Sources for Bees in Different Environments

When it comes to providing bees with access to water, understanding the different water sources available in various environments is crucial. Bees in rural areas may rely on natural water sources like ponds, lakes, and streams for their hydration needs. For instance, a pond’s shallow edges can provide an ideal spot for bees to drink and land without getting wet.

In contrast, urban beekeepers often have limited access to natural water sources. However, this doesn’t mean they’re out of options. Birdbaths and bee-friendly fountains can be excellent alternatives. These man-made water sources not only supply bees with the water they need but also provide a safe landing spot for them to rest while collecting water.

In areas where natural water sources are scarce or unreliable, creating a bee-friendly fountain or birdbath specifically designed for bees is an ideal solution. These fountains and baths come equipped with features like shallow dishes and gentle flows that make it easy for bees to access the water without drowning.

Best Practices for Maintaining Clean and Safe Water Sources

Maintaining clean and safe water sources is crucial for the health and productivity of your bees. A dirty or contaminated water source can spread diseases and attract pests, ultimately affecting the overall well-being of your colony. To avoid this, it’s essential to implement a regular maintenance routine.

Check the water source regularly for signs of contamination, such as algae growth or mosquito larvae. Change the water completely if you notice any of these signs. You should also ensure that the water is fresh and not stagnant. Consider changing the water every 2-3 days during hot weather, especially if you live in an area with high temperatures.

Can I use a single water source for multiple hives, or should each hive have its own?

While it’s tempting to consolidate resources, it’s generally recommended to provide separate water sources for each hive to prevent overcrowding and competition for water. This can lead to stress on the bees and potentially affect their health and productivity. However, if space is limited, a larger water source with multiple feeding points or divisions may be used. Be sure to maintain cleanliness and accessibility for all hives.

How do I ensure my bees are getting enough water during hot summer months?

During heatwaves, bees require more water to compensate for increased evaporation and energy expenditure. Ensure your bees have access to a reliable, clean water source that’s easily accessible and shaded to prevent water from becoming too warm or stagnant. Consider adding multiple water sources or using a system with circulating water to maintain freshness and quality.
